资讯
如何充分利用各种类型的断点(2021-09-18)
就可以发挥巨大的作用,成为开发工作中的利器。
断点的概念非常简单,因为它的作用是在指定指令之前中断程序的执行。实现方式可以是硬件或软件。然而,简单并不意味着它不能被用于复杂的调试组合中,以达到用简单的方式解决BUG的目......
一文详解80C51单片机的中断系统(2024-03-13)
外部硬件或者内部组件有紧急的请求(如通信,断点,发生重大故障等),中断系统就可以将当前的程序暂停,优先处理这些中断请求。
这种处理方式,对整个系统的稳定性,健壮性至关重要,同时......
简单实用!STM32硬件错误的调试技巧(2023-06-08)
式来定位到出错代码段。
方法1:
在硬件中断函数HardFault_Handler里的while(1)处打调试断点,程序执行到断点处时点击STOP停止仿真。
示例
1.2 在Keil菜单栏点击View......
怎样调试STM32硬件错误HardFault(2024-08-09)
式来定位到出错代码段。
方法1:
在硬件中断函数HardFault_Handler里的while(1)处打调试断点,程序执行到断点处时点击STOP停止仿真。
示例
在Keil菜单栏点击View......
基于8051单片机的中断控制(2024-01-17)
单片机内部的自然优先级顺序(外部中断0→定时器0中断→外部中断l→定时器1中断→串行接口中断)响应中断。
CPU响应中断请求后,就立即转入执行中断服务程序。保护断点、寻找中断源、中断处理、中断返回,程序返回断点......
51单片机外部中断处理源程序(2022-12-26)
中断时点亮
led2=0;
led3=0;
led3=0; //可以在此设一个断点
}
if(FINT1){ //中断1来到要做什么事情
FINT1=0;
led1=1; //INT1中断......
软件断点的介绍(2024-07-11)
调试模式下就会自动停止单片机运行(如果不在在线调试模式,也会进入停止运行,所以需要后面的优化方案)。比如hardfault错误很难查,但是你可以在进入这个中断后,立刻执行一条汇编软件断点代码:
BKPT......
MCS-51的中断响应过程解析(2024-03-21)
相应优先级状态触发器置1;(2)执行一个硬件子程序的调用,1)硬件清零相应中断请求标志(TI、RI除外)2)将当前PC内容压入堆栈——保护断点;3)将中断服务子程序入口地址送PC——转移。返回过程:(RETI......
一文详解MCS-51单片机的中断系统(2023-02-02)
;现场保护与现场恢复。
中断返回
最后指令为RETI,功能为:
将断点从堆栈弹送PC,CPU从原断点继续执行将相应优先级状态触发器清0,恢复原来工作状态
8051中断程序设计
中断......
第7章 中断系统(2024-08-09)
当前指令,响应该中断申请,同时把主程序断点处地址(程序计数器PC当前值)压入堆栈,即保护断点;
保护现场。把断点处的有关信息(如工作寄存器、累加器、标志位的内容),压入堆栈;
执行中断服务程序;
恢复......
外部中断_单片机_普中(2024-08-05)
处理过程
① 响应中断请求。当 CPU 正在执行主程序时,如果接收到中断源发出的中断请求信号,就会响应中断请求,停止主程序,开始执行中断。
② 保护断点。为了在执行完中断后能返回主程序,在执行中断时,会将......
DMA带中断的内存到内存传输(2024-05-06)
DMA带中断的内存到内存传输; 要使用中断配置 DMA,请按照内存到内存模式部分中详述的步骤进行操作。
在System Core 》 NVIC中启用DMA1 Channel 1 Global......
超详细讲解S7-200PLC自由口通讯(2023-01-11)
数据将按照发送的顺序进入信息缓冲区,直到结束条件的满足,结束条件满足以后SMB86/186不再等于0,之后接收过程结束并产生接收信息完成中断。在整个过程中最为重要的就是起始条件和结束条件,想要......
浅谈AT89S51中断程序设计(2023-07-21)
完这条指令后,把响应中断时所置l的不可寻址的优先级状态触发器清O,然后从堆栈中弹出栈顶上的两个字节的断点地址送到程序计数器PC,弹出的第一个字节送入PCH,弹出的第二个字节送入PCL,CPU从断点处重新执行被中断......
μC/OS-II操作系统移植在LPC2378上的系统测试及问题解决方法(2023-04-07)
来实现。中断服务子程序、TRAP或者异常处理的向量地址必须指向OSCtXSW(),利用系统在跳转到中断服务程序时会自动把断点指针压入堆栈的功能,把断点指针存入堆栈,而利用中断返回指令IRET,能把断点......
51单片机启动过程(2024-07-29)
只允许在其一端进行数据插入和数据删除的线性表。51单片机的单片机的堆栈是在内部RAM中开辟的。这句话表明了堆栈的位置。
那么堆栈到底有什么作用?
堆栈主要是为子程序调用和中断操作而设立的,因此对应有两项功能:保护断点......
基于STM32F429的定时器中断点亮LED的设计(2023-09-21)
基于STM32F429的定时器中断点亮LED的设计;电子时代,硬件在突飞猛进的发展,频率不断上升,目前的STM32系列,Cortex M系列,Cortex-M4的频率已经为:180MHz了,基本......
SIMATIC S7-1500 PLC中断的概念及其过程(2024-07-05)
程序块中的程序执行完成后,再转到主程序块OB1中,从断点处执行主程序。
事件源就是能向PLC发出中断请求的中断事件,例如日期时间中断、延时中断、循环中断和编程错误引起的中断等。
(2)OB的优先级
执行一个组织块OB......
AT89S51单片机的两种低功耗节电工作模式解析(2023-05-19)
种是硬件复位方式。
在空闲模式下,若任何一个允许的中断请求被响应时,IDL位被片内硬件自动清0,从而退出空闲模式。当执行完中断服务程序返回时,将从设置空闲模式指令的下一条指令(断点处)开始......
51单片机外部中断点亮LED(2023-01-12)
51单片机外部中断点亮LED;外部中断软件设计原理
中断发生的三个条件
①中断源有中断请求;
②此中断源的中断允许位为 1;
③CPU 开中断(即 EA=1)。
比如我们配置外部中断 0,对应......
基于51单片机利用中断实现100以内的按键计数(2023-02-01)
,0x07,0x7f,0x6f
中断系统
执行现程序的过程中,出现某些急需处理的异常情况或特殊请求,CPU暂时中止现行程序,而转去对这些异常情况或特殊请求进行处理,在处理完毕后CPU又自动返回到现行程序的断点......
面向复杂道路实车路试条件下的数据记录(2024-01-04)
防止数据因网络质量而丢失,系统独立检查数据包是否已正确和完整地传输。只有这样,CF存储卡上的内存空间才会再次释放以用于新数据存放。如果移动通信在某些点中断,无需担心数据丢失,传输将在稍后的时间点恢复,并进行断点......
STM32芯片异常复位的原因有哪些(2023-06-20)
确定复位的原因,是硬件复位,如外部NRST被拉低,还是软件复位,包括软件直接调用复位,或者看门狗复位,还是低功耗模式如standby模式被唤醒时产生中断。
查看复位状态寄存器了解复位大方向,然后......
STM32速成笔记(1)概述(2024-01-31)
的一款单片机,32指32位。STM32也可以成为32位微处理器。STM32F103ZET6的主时钟频率为72MHz,512KB的FLASH,64KB的SRAM。常用到的有GPIO,中断,ADC,TMR......
基于51单片机实现旋转LED灯报警(Proteus仿真)(2023-02-01)
LED灯
Proteus仿真原理图:
仿真:
知识介绍:
Proteus布线
为了让整个原理图看上去简洁明了,我们对元器件的导线进行标号,而不是直接和芯片相连。
定时中断系统简图
定时器资源
定时......
采用嵌入式芯片和Zigbee通信芯片设计停车诱导系统(2023-04-06)
数据库中的车位状态,运行停车位寻优算法,向用户反馈最佳车位信息等。
在协调器结点中,需要以下主要器件:1)一块嵌入式控制器芯片,用于管理嵌入式数据库;2)一块Zigbee通信芯片,用于......
基于LL库实现STM32U5 LPTIM功能(2024-08-22)
如下基于LL库的用户代码:
进行编译、调试后即可看到输出结果,在中断里打断点也可以感受到中断的产生。
后来,我又使用STM32G4开发板,基于LL库组织了针对LPTIM1的PWM及相关中断的实现代码。照样......
STM32——粗谈基础知识(2023-04-06)
可以通过执行WFI或者WFE指令进入睡眠模式。
使用WFI指令,内核会在有中断的请求下从睡眠状态恢复,并且执行中断服务。
使用WFE指令,让内核进入睡眠模式,内核遇到唤醒事件就会被唤醒,并从其进入睡眠模式的断点......
关键晶圆厂停工10天,或冲击全球半导体供应链一年(2022-11-02)
半导体供应链研究,发现关键性晶圆厂短暂停工10天,可能冲击整个供应链,影响时间长达一年。
据了解,该研究设定两项核心指标,包括生存时间(TTS)和恢复时间(TTR)。生存时间指关键节点中断后,供应......
STM32单片机的调试方式 STM32单片机的启动流程详解(2024-08-05)
电子等领域。
STM32单片机的调试方式:
1.使用JTAG调试器:JTAG调试器是一种常用的调试工具,可以用于单步执行、断点调试等操作。在STM32单片机中,可以使用ST-Link......
pcb开路分析:揭秘电子元件背后的“故障密码(2024-10-23 22:29:29)
可以采取以下步骤:
1. 使用万用表或示波器等工具检查 PCB 上的开路位置,确认确切的中断点。
2. 确保 PCB 表面干净,并用......
STM32外部中断执行过程(2024-03-08)
或异常产生会一直在while(1)里执行主程序代码。当中断产生后,当前执行的任务会被打断,程序跳转到中断处理函数执行,执行完会返回之前的主程序断点处继续执行。
中断处理函数:
void......
分析一个关于STM32 芯片异常复位的经典案例!(2022-12-20)
软件直接调用复位,或者看门狗复位,还是低功耗模式如standby模式被唤醒时产生中断;
2、查看复位状态寄存器了解复位大方向,然后做进一步得拆解分析。
3、目前客户项目的复位原因是因为看门狗复位,即客......
联想陈振宽:通过万全异构智算平台,联想迎接AI 2.0(2024-04-22)
时间。陈振宽强调,目前千卡集群每月至少有15次的故障断点。在常规的断点续训手段下,每次恢复训练需要几个小时,产生的额外费用超过百万元。随着AI集群规模从千卡到万卡,故障中断......
基于51单片机之间的双向通信(Proteus仿真)(2023-01-31)
去对这些异常情况或特殊请求进行处理,在处理完毕后CPU又自动返回到现行程序的断点处,继续执行原程序
中断号:
外部中断0 interrupt 0
定时器0 interrupt 1
外部中断1......
ARM9的中断处理技术详细深入剖析-三星S3C2440处理器(2022-12-07)
处理代码
2 、按键中断点亮LED
先将之前写的代码进行优化(将各个部分的代码移植到相应新建的.c文件中)(主要是touch ~~.c chmod 777 ~~.c)
1)中断源的初始化
将四个按键对应的引脚设为外部中断......
基于C51中断过程及interrupt和using的使用(2023-09-07)
节省代码和时间一般只有using 0,1,2,3
单片机中断响应可以分为以下几个步骤:1、停止主程序运行。当前指令执行完后立即终止现行程序的运行。2、保护断点。把程序计数器PC 的当前值压入堆栈,保存......
C51单片机interrupt和using的使用(2023-09-06)
、保护断点。把程序计数器PC 的当前值压入堆栈,保存终止的地址(即断点地址),以便从中断服务程序返回时能继续执行该程序,3、寻找中断入口。根据5 个不同的中断源所产生的中断,查找5 个不......
STM32基础知识:中断系统(2024-02-23)
该程序执行相应操作。
2.5 中断响应过程
中断源发出中断请求。
判断处理器是否允许中断,以及该中断源是否被屏蔽。
中断优先级排队。
处理器暂停当前程序,保护断点地址和处理器的当前状态,根据中断......
STC8G 系列单片机规格参数 -- 内部集成了增强型的双数据指针(2024-07-29)
约快 12 倍以上
指令代码完全兼容传统 8051
16 个中断源,4 级中断优先级
支持在线仿真
工作电压
1.9V~5.5V
内建 LDO
工作温度
-40......
【MCS-51】汇编程序设计(2023-04-23)
) 编辑器:用于编写源代码,支持代码高亮和自动完成等功能。
(2) 汇编器:用于将源代码转换为机器指令,生成目标文件或可执行文件。
(3) 调试器:用于调试和验证程序运行效果,支持单步调试、断点......
一个隐秘的串口中断BUG案例分享(2024-06-19)
即RXNEIE=1时,则有ORE标识溢出时也会进入中断,该标志需要手动清除,如果不清除则会反复进入中断。项目中是使能接收非空中断的即RXNEIE=1。
三.问题验证
在中断服务函数中打断点,然后......
什么是冷启动和热启动 西门子PLC的热启动,冷启动有什么区别?(2024-07-29)
器、计数器、过程映像及数据块的当前值)被保持。CPU会自动调用OB101一次,然后程序从断点处(断电, CPU STOP) 恢复执行。这个“剩余循环”执行完后,循环程序OB1开始执行。
03 冷启......
浅谈西门子暖启动、热启动、冷启动(2024-08-06)
映像及数据块的当前值)被保持。CPU会自动调用OB101一次,然后程序从断点处(断电, CPU STOP) 恢复执行。这个“剩余循环”执行完后,循环程序OB1开始执行。
03 冷启动
CPU318-2和 417-4......
因STM32移植而引发的两个小疑问(2024-08-20)
栈时就不提这几个时钟的时间了,只说压栈时间。
对于前面提到的第2次基于咬尾机制进中断的情形,如果希望得到较为直观地体验、感受,可以借助断点,观察栈帧的变化来满足。我们可以明显地观察到中断服务程序运行了两次,压栈只发生一次。
......
单片微机原理P2:80C51外部中断与定时器系统(2024-08-21)
单片微机原理P2:80C51外部中断与定时器系统;0. 外部中断
书上的废话当然是很多的了,对于中断我想大家应该早就有一个很直观的认识,就是“设置断点,执行外部外码,然后返回断点”这样......
十、S3C2440 开发资源(2023-07-11)
输入支持缩放)
130 个通用 I/O 口和 24 通道外部中断源
具有普通,慢速,空闲和掉电模式
具有 PLL 片上时钟发生器
10.2 JZ2440 烧写程序
10.2.1 系统安装
镜像在 PC 上......
Jlink 软件断点和硬件断点(2024-08-01)
Jlink 软件断点和硬件断点;调试2440 RAM拷贝至SDRAM遇到的问题
汇编代码主要是初始化一些寄存器,关狗,初始化时钟,初始化存储管理器以便访问内存,然后将SoC上4k RAM数据......
基于恩智浦MPC5744P的电机FOC控制中电流的采样(2023-05-24)
电流的同步采样,通过PWM触发CTU,CTU事件触发ADC电流采样,在CTU的中断中去获取电流的ADC值,经过滤波后就可以做电流算法的闭环控制,这个芯片的ADC 有两种模式。
我们......
天惠微代理山景AP8264A2 适用DSP方案 可烧录 USB声卡USB麦克风(2023-09-27)
SPI FLASH,存储代码及数据
➢ 支持外接 PSRAM 存储器
➢ 内置 EFUSE 配置存储器
➢ 2 线 SDP(Serial Debug Port)调试口,具备断点......
相关企业
;智点中国;;智点中国网--专业为你提供各种网络创业、网络兼职信息,教你怎样赚钱!欢迎访问http://www.zhidian518.com
/ 15KV 就太轻松了 超低功耗,Power Down < 0.1uA, 可外部中断唤醒 中断优先级可设置成4级(IP,IPH) LQFP-44,PLCC-44封装,有P4口(可以位寻址) 并增加2
;上海虎少年家教中心;;虎少年家教中心,特邀本市重点中学特、高级教师筹划创办的以广大中学生为主要辅导对象的专业中学生课外辅导机构。主要从事中学生课外辅导,个性化教育及家庭教育心理咨询等业务。 本中
;厦门点点中国;;点点中国生活联盟,以倡导时尚生活、创建优秀服务品牌为宗旨,为广大消费者提供最优惠、最方便、最全面、最及时的本地化餐饮、娱乐、消费等优惠促销信息;同时给商家带来直接的消费群体,网站
;深圳市宝义隆科技有限公司;;深圳市宝义隆科技有限公司成立于2001年,位于宝安区福永镇兴围工业区,专业生产高频网络滤波器、寻线仪,查线器,红光笔,光纤测试笔,光纤断点测试仪,网线测试仪,ADSL
控网络系统的光缆架设和光纤熔接。工控传输光缆敷设和光纤熔接。安全监控工程。监控产品代理等多个项目。 工程承接 工程服务 测试服务 光纤熔接含热缩管不含尾纤/含热缩管含尾纤光缆线路抢修已知断点/未知断点
;东海透明开关(临沂)有限公司;;本公司位于具有悠久历史的书圣故里物流之都临沂市。“专注看得见的安全”,主要经营具有明显可见分断点的透明断路器,透明漏电断路器,透明小型断路器,明显
为客户提供性价比最高的产品及最安心的售后服务. 公司自主研发的音视频光端机,电话光端机,以太网光纤收发器及光纤断点测量仪器等,产品质量稳定,性价比高,客户大量应用于高速公路,隧道,机场等安防监控系统中, 得到
;杭州贸易公司;;日本地震后,业内就预测日产电子产品价格将会出现大幅上涨。如今,这种预测变成了现实。 日本是硅的最大供应国,占全球供应的60%左右。如果日本的物流和基础设施问题导致硅供应中断
声压动态低频增益,听感通透,富有弹性。 【时尚便携】小巧机身、时尚精致,携带方便。 【双模供电】支持电脑USB供电或锂电池供电,双供电模式自由选择。 【断点记忆播放】自动记忆上次退出时的播放曲目,SD卡/USB